Default Spark plugs

So I recently bought a fairlady and I know this is probably a stupid question but how many spark plugs does it have(to replace all of the old ones). And what are some good spark plugs to get

Welcome and your first post is going to set you back some. What needs to be said is the engines are all V-6s and so, you only need SIX spark plugs. Get the same NGK plugs for best results though, and that does depend on what year Z (Fairlady) you have.
